Management
Bachelor of Science in Business Administration Degree
![]()
|
The Department of Management in the Harmon College of Business and Professional Studies (HCBPS) at UCM offers students educational experiences that will help them address the challenges of business in a wide variety of careers.
The Management Department offers a Bachelor of Science in Business Administration (BSBA) with a major in Management. We also offer a Management minor. The courses in the BSBA in Management major utilize a team-based experiential learning approach, rather than lecture, to help students understand both the theory and practice of management.
In the BSBA in Management major, our students will be given the opportunity to:
- Become more effective decision makers
- Organize activities to implement decisions
- Deliver effective oral presentations and written communications
- Lead others effectively
- Develop skills and attitudes required for life-long learning and serving others

The Integrative Business Experience (IBE)
The BSBA in Management requires the IBE. IBE classes create, operate, and execute start-up businesses (based on bank loans of up to $5,000 per business) and manage handson service projects for non-profit organizations. In the last 7 years, IBE teams have donated more than $200,000 in profits to non-profit organizations and have completed service projects involving more than 7,000 hours for the community.
